Welcome to the ‘Department of Memories’.
For four nights a fictional department will pop up inside the Museum of Australian Democracy at Old Parliament House. The Department of Memories is dedicated to collecting, and carefully cataloguing a time you changed your mind, the first time you needed your neighbour’s help, or where you were when a big thing happened. Memories, whether they be brave, silly, awkward, painful, or powerful are the strange glue that holds democracy together.
Cartoonist and illustrator, Sam Wallman, gives you a peek inside the Department of Memories, showcases collected memories we can all relate to and shows how peoples stories are central to how we relate to each other.

About the artist: Sam Wallman is a cartoonist and illustrator based in Naarm (Melbourne). Sam’s work has been published in the Guardian, the New York Times, Labor Notes, The Age, the ABC and SBS.
